Material and Build
The tool features drop forged steel construction with a heat treatment shaft, creating a structure designed to withstand the pressures involved in automotive disassembly work. Drop forging creates a dense grain structure in the steel, improving its resistance to impact and bending forces when removing stubborn trim clips or brackets. The heat treatment process further enhances the steel's mechanical properties, increasing hardness and strength where needed while maintaining sufficient toughness to prevent brittle fracture. This combination of manufacturing techniques results in a tool that maintains its shape and function through repeated use in typical automotive repair environments.
